Friday, April 25, 2008TENNIS BLOCK PARTY TO PROVIDE OPPORTUNITY TO LEARN ABOUT THE GAME
LAWRENCE – Lawrence Parks and Recreation Department, the United States Tennis Association and First Serve will hold a Tennis Block Party from 10 a.m. to 12 p.m. Saturday, May 3, at the Lawrence Tennis Center, 21st and Virginia Sts.
The Tennis Block Party is free and open to all ages and abilities.
The block party is an opportunity for individuals to learn the basics of tennis, as well as the social and health benefits of the game. The session will feature tennis instruction, interactive games and other attractions.
In the event of inclement weather, the event will be moved to First Serve, 5200 Clinton Parkway.
